Transaction 431ab4eaf1ad410855910a9577d3a55091abc19dd767a94bd564d05f84cdc118
1 Input
1 Output
-
431ab4eaf1ad410855910a9577d3a55091abc19dd767a94bd564d05f84cdc118:0
- value
- 38514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 642546d1a602609b2559b1cc0fbce2de63febf2e OP_EQUAL
- address
- 3ApY9kd2QZSXwYVpLYLYjdwvVb1VGfUrBU